Output dee898304feff037a7b4600a5470488ac98768e6f56aba2a64c832961ee37e85:0

value
24449106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f0ae754199704d8830940730e8a2b3501e89e28 OP_EQUAL
address
34X9w63ZENk5GgnDq2mpNwaZiLRTr4ewVi
transaction
dee898304feff037a7b4600a5470488ac98768e6f56aba2a64c832961ee37e85
confirmations
286749
spent
true